diff --git a/kinit-admin/src/components/Menu/src/Menu.vue b/kinit-admin/src/components/Menu/src/Menu.vue index 3aa89fe..42e0398 100644 --- a/kinit-admin/src/components/Menu/src/Menu.vue +++ b/kinit-admin/src/components/Menu/src/Menu.vue @@ -80,25 +80,28 @@ export default defineComponent({ const renderMenu = () => { return ( - - {{ - default: () => { - const { renderMenuItem } = useRenderMenuItem(unref(menuMode)) - return renderMenuItem(unref(routers)) + + + uniqueOpened={unref(layout) === 'top' ? false : unref(uniqueOpened)} + backgroundColor="var(--left-menu-bg-color)" + textColor="var(--left-menu-text-color)" + activeTextColor="var(--left-menu-text-active-color)" + onSelect={menuSelect} + ellipsis={false} + > + {{ + default: () => { + const { renderMenuItem } = useRenderMenuItem(unref(menuMode)) + return renderMenuItem(unref(routers)) + } + }} + + ) } diff --git a/kinit-admin/src/layout/components/AppView.vue b/kinit-admin/src/layout/components/AppView.vue index 4ef5b28..8741d24 100644 --- a/kinit-admin/src/layout/components/AppView.vue +++ b/kinit-admin/src/layout/components/AppView.vue @@ -20,7 +20,7 @@ const getCaches = computed((): string[] => { diff --git a/kinit-admin/src/styles/index.less b/kinit-admin/src/styles/index.less index 1dfbe1d..8238735 100644 --- a/kinit-admin/src/styles/index.less +++ b/kinit-admin/src/styles/index.less @@ -11,4 +11,7 @@ width: 100% !important; } - +// 解决element-plus 中的日期组件宽度无法设置100%的问题 +.el-table__body tr.current-row>td.el-table__cell { + background-color: #a0cfff !important; +} \ No newline at end of file